Grammar A. some and any B. somebody, anybody, somebody, etc. some and any some: 一些 any: 任何 What do they mean some and any What kinds of nouns follow them We use some and any before _____ and _____. plural countable nouns uncountable nouns some and any What kinds of sentence are they in We usually use some in _____, and any in _____ and _____. positive statements negative statements questions some and any We use some and any as determiners to talk about amounts. We also use them as indefinite pronouns to refer to people or things. We usually use some in positive statements, and any in negative statements and questions. Let’s sum up the rules! Are there any exceptions (例外) some and any We use _____ in questions when we expect the answer to be “yes”. It is also a polite way to ask. some Would you like some tea May I have some noodles We can use ____ to talk about someone or something when we do not refer to a specific person or thing. any You can take any book you’d like to read.
